U.S. Support for Democracy, Human Rights a Pretext

TEHRAN, June 1(Mehr News Agency) -- The U.S. and its allies have proved that in order to deny the Islamic Republic of Iran of its legitimate rights, they are ready to commit any crimes, a Foreign Ministry adviser said on Tuesday.

“After the former Iraqi regime supported by the U.S., used chemical

weapons and committed other criminal acts in its war against Iran

back in 1988, the U.S. attacked Iranian airliner and completed Saddam's brutalities in its eight-year imposed war on Iran," Javad Manosuri told the Mehr News Agency.

 

“The defeat of the Baath regime in Iraq was almost evident in 1988,

and the U.S. Israel and other Western countries were well aware of

the fact,” he added, “But, they were anxious to see that the defeat was going to be inflicted by an independent state in the region.”

 

“They could not stand it. So in order to avoid it, they first bombarded the Iranian oil platforms, oil tankers and then they attacked the Iranian civilian airliner and killed some 300 innocent people on board," Mansouri said.

 

The official went on to say that the U.S. crimes against the Islamic Iran has continued up to the moment.

 

“It is funny to see that all these offenses are carried out by the number one advocate of the American style human rights and democracy in the world,” he said.
